یکپارچه سازی معماری نرم افزار به فرآیند ترکیب سیستم ها یا اجزای مختلف نرم افزار در یک راه حل یکپارچه واحد اشاره دارد. این شامل طراحی معماری اجزای سیستم و اطمینان از کارکرد یکپارچه آنها برای دستیابی به عملکرد، عملکرد و قابلیت اطمینان مورد نظر است. فرآیند یکپارچه سازی ممکن است شامل یکپارچه سازی زبان های برنامه نویسی مختلف، پلتفرم ها، پروتکل ها و فرمت های داده باشد و ممکن است برای دستیابی به قابلیت همکاری نیاز به استفاده از رابط های استاندارد و API داشته باشد. این یک جنبه حیاتی از توسعه نرم افزار است که در حصول اطمینان از اینکه محصول نرم افزاری نهایی نیازهای کاربران نهایی را برآورده می کند و همانطور که انتظار می رود عمل می کند، نقش مهمی ایفا می کند.
تاریخ انتشار: